LiteSpeed\Cloud D

Total Complexity 353
Dependencies 15
Dependents 15
Total lines 2,034
Lines of code 1,279
Logical lines of code 837
Comment lines 389
Methods 60
Properties 11

Methods 60

Method Rating Maintainability Complexity Lines of code
extract_msg()
D
30 34 105
detect_cloud()
C
35 26 77
_maybe_cloud()
B
35 22 85
_parse_response()
B
33 21 97
allowance()
A
46 16 37
handler()
A
45 13 46
_update_news()
A
50 13 26
_get_closest_nodes()
A
46 12 36
_load_qc_status_for_dash()
A
49 11 27
ping()
A
51 10 26
_post()
A
45 9 39
init_qc_cdn_cli()
A
48 8 36
finish_qc_activation()
A
48 8 30
is_from_cloud()
A
52 8 25
_get()
A
48 7 32
check_dev_version()
S
54 7 20
_get_ref_url()
S
58 7 16
init_qc()
S
48 5 35
init_qc_cli()
S
48 5 35
version_check()
S
56 6 16
_load_server_pk()
S
50 5 28
update_qc_activation()
S
54 5 21
update_cdn_status()
S
54 5 20
wp_rest_echo()
S
55 5 18
_is_err_domain()
S
58 5 16
rest_err_domains()
S
60 5 13
_validate_signature()
S
58 4 15
sync_usage()
S
61 4 12
clear_cloud()
S
62 4 12
_sign_b64()
S
57 3 17
news()
S
64 4 10
_parse_link()
S
62 4 10
ip_validate()
S
59 3 13
_qc_time_file()
S
62 3 11
link_qc()
S
56 2 18
enable_cdn()
S
56 2 18
_update_ips()
S
57 2 16
__construct()
S
65 3 9
has_pkg()
S
69 3 6
service_hot()
S
64 3 10
reset_qc()
S
59 2 14
init_qc_prepare()
S
62 2 12
link_qc_cli()
S
62 2 12
api_link_call()
S
62 2 11
cdn_status_cli()
S
65 2 9
_maybe_queue()
S
71 2 6
activated()
S
77 2 3
_reset_qc_reg()
S
65 2 9
show_promo()
S
71 2 6
_clear_promo()
S
67 2 8
maybe_preview_banner()
S
72 2 5
load_qc_status_for_dash()
S
79 1 3
get()
S
75 1 4
qc_link()
S
66 1 8
post()
S
74 1 4
_reset_qc_reg_content()
S
69 1 6
_clear_reset_qc_reg_msg()
S
72 1 5
_remove_domain_from_err_list()
S
76 1 4
ok()
S
76 1 4
err()
S
68 1 7